Who is Novelist Edmund White?
An American novelist, commentator, and memoir writer, he is best known for The Joy of Gay Sex, a sex guide for men who have sex with men. His memoirs include Story of the Own Boy (1982) and The Farewell Symphony (1997).
He published his first novel, Forgetting Elena, in 1973.
 
 

Young / Before famous

He graduated from the University of Michigan with a degree in Chinese studies and later worked as a freelancer for Newsweek magazine.

Family life info

He was born in Cincinnati, Ohio, and he was raised in Chicago, Illinois. For many years he lived with his partner, Michael Carroll.
